SUSE CVE-2018-14367
In Wireshark 2.6.0 to 2.6.1 and 2.4.0 to 2.4.7, the CoAP protocol dissector could crash. This was addressed in epan/dissectors/packet-coap.c by properly checking for a NULL condition...
SUSE CVE-2018-18225
In Wireshark 2.6.0 to 2.6.3, the CoAP dissector could crash. This was addressed in epan/dissectors/packet-coap.c by ensuring that the piv length is correctly computed...

CVE-2020-36444
Summary (CVE-2020-36444) : The issue affects the Rust crate async-coap (through 2020-12-08). The Send/Sync implementations for ArcGuard are defined without trait bounds on RC. This enables scenarios where RC may be non-Send or non-Sync to be sent across threads, and allows concurrent access to RC...
